Baking rye bread

Rye has been harvested in the Valais for centuries. The conditions here are highly favourable: mountainous terrain, high elevation and extreme temperatures. The Valaisians turn their rye into delicious bread. In former times Valais villagers fired their communal ovens two or three times per year. So they needed to develop a type of bread that would last for several months: the incomparable Valais rye bread.
